现在linux版vmware不支持32位系统统了吗

怎样让64位linux支持32_百度知道
怎样让64位linux支持32
我有更好的答案
Linux和Win不一样,64位系统不能运行32位应用。尝试安装ia32吧,如果是Debian/Ubuntu系列: sudo apt-get install ia32-libs
采纳率:73%
百度来的,请参考大部分Linux发行套件都有针对x86_64处理器的版本。比较典型的x86_64的处理器有ADM Athlon II和英特尔Xeon。因为这些Linux发行套件都有自己专用的软件源,这些软件源会为提供所有它所支持的应用软件的二进制包。如果你满足于Linux的安装方式,你可能不会需要运行32位的程序。一些Linux商业软件,尤其是游戏,只提供32的版本。因为某些特殊的理由,你可能需要配置你的电脑来运行32位的软件。安装32位的支持库因为x86_64处理器是为x86技术涉及,所以它也是支持32位程序的。在Linux里,你所需要做的就是为这些软件安装必要的软件库。幸运的是,大部分Linux发行版本已经将这些打包好了。比方在Ubuntu里,这个包就叫做ia32-libs。为了安装它,你可以打开一个终端,然后输入下面的内容:sudo apt-get install ia32-libs在Kubuntu中,你也可以通过Synaptic和Kpackagekit在图形界面下安装。一旦安装了之后,像游戏之类的软件就不再需要更多的配置。图形问题当你在一个64位的环境中运行32位的软件时,Ubuntu仍然会去寻找默认的GTK引擎。这样导致一个wrong ELF class的报错。这种情况在你运行某些特定的软件的时候特别恼人,比方说Chrome,一款新的谷歌浏览器开源版本。Ubuntu确实已经将32位版本的GTK引擎安装在了 /usr/lib32/gtk-2.0,但是我所使用的GTK项目并没有在这个位置找到。快速的解决方法如下:1、为你现在用的主题找到32位包。比方说我,我查找了ubuntu packages2、下载包,然后将包解压缩3、为主题找到库文件4、将库拷贝到lib32路径:sudo cp ~/download-directory/usr/lib/gtk-2.0/2.10.0/engines/libqtcurve.so /usr/lib32/gtk-2.0/2.10.0/engines/比方说Chrome,它的需要可以设置在启动脚本里: /user/lib32/gtk-2.0如果程序的启动脚本在你运行的时候没有去看,而是去寻找 /user.lib/gtk-2.0,你可能需要修改启动脚本或者在终端里输出并设置一个环境变量:export GTK_PATH=/usr/lib32/gtk-2.0 command-to-start-app如果一个程序没有启动脚本,你可以像上面那样设置下环境变量。其他的错误我已经发现了像Boxee这样的应用程序,不能很好地在任何情况运行在64位系统下,即使在安装了32位的库文件也不行。这时候唯一可行的办法就是在根下运行了。
为您推荐:
其他类似问题
linux的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。现在linux版不支持32位系统了吗_百度知道
现在linux版不支持32位系统了吗
我有更好的答案
为您推荐:
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。新手园地& & & 硬件问题Linux系统管理Linux网络问题Linux环境编程Linux桌面系统国产LinuxBSD& & & BSD文档中心AIX& & & 新手入门& & & AIX文档中心& & & 资源下载& & & Power高级应用& & & IBM存储AS400Solaris& & & Solaris文档中心HP-UX& & & HP文档中心SCO UNIX& & & SCO文档中心互操作专区IRIXTru64 UNIXMac OS X门户网站运维集群和高可用服务器应用监控和防护虚拟化技术架构设计行业应用和管理服务器及硬件技术& & & 服务器资源下载云计算& & & 云计算文档中心& & & 云计算业界& & & 云计算资源下载存储备份& & & 存储文档中心& & & 存储业界& & & 存储资源下载& & & Symantec技术交流区安全技术网络技术& & & 网络技术文档中心C/C++& & & GUI编程& & & Functional编程内核源码& & & 内核问题移动开发& & & 移动开发技术资料ShellPerlJava& & & Java文档中心PHP& & & php文档中心Python& & & Python文档中心RubyCPU与编译器嵌入式开发驱动开发Web开发VoIP开发技术MySQL& & & MySQL文档中心SybaseOraclePostgreSQLDB2Informix数据仓库与数据挖掘NoSQL技术IT业界新闻与评论IT职业生涯& & & 猎头招聘IT图书与评论& & & CU技术图书大系& & & Linux书友会二手交易下载共享Linux文档专区IT培训与认证& & & 培训交流& & & 认证培训清茶斋投资理财运动地带快乐数码摄影& & & 摄影器材& & & 摄影比赛专区IT爱车族旅游天下站务交流版主会议室博客SNS站务交流区CU活动专区& & & Power活动专区& & & 拍卖交流区频道交流区
白手起家, 积分 23, 距离下一级还需 177 积分
论坛徽章:0
我的是CentOS 6.0 32位操作系统,已经把内核换成64位的,我想在上面安装64位glibc,然后安装64位gcc,然后编译和运行64位应用程序。用的是rpm包
我的问题是:
1.可以在32位系统上安装64位glibc和64位gcc吗?如果不行,为什么?
2.如果可以安装,那么可以利用之前安装的64位gcc和glibc,编译和运行64位应用程序嘛?(可以再32位系统上编译出64位程序)
巨富豪门, 积分 38223, 距离下一级还需 1777 积分
论坛徽章:4
1,你没有64位编译器, 只能通过发行版本的RPM直接安装.
2,既然你系统是64的, 编译器和开发库也是64的, 应该是没问题的.
白手起家, 积分 23, 距离下一级还需 177 积分
论坛徽章:0
现在已经把内核换成64位的
Linux efw-.localdomain 2.6.32-220.el6.x86_64 #1 SMP Tue Dec 6 19:48:22 GMT
x86_64 x86_64 GNU/Linux
但是应用层的还是32位,不知道这个怎么变
# getconf LONG_BIT
rpm在安装时,应该要检测操作系统的类型,然后和rpm包中的申明的系统类型匹配
我试过了,在换成64位内核的32位linux上安装64位的glibc-common rpm包,安装失败
命令:rpm -ivh glibc-common-2.5-81.el5_8.4.x86_64.rpm --nodeps --force
错误信息:“package glibc-common-2.5-81.el5_8.4.x86_64 is intended for a x86_64 architecture”
linux_c_py_php
巨富豪门, 积分 38223, 距离下一级还需 1777 积分
论坛徽章:4
母鸡, 去内核板块问问.
论坛徽章:95
冷秋风扫落叶
& & RPM 这个问题改改 /usr/lib/rpm/rpmrc,把 x86_64 设成和 i686 兼容应该就可以了。
不过,你这个情况,还是重装个 64 位的系统更方便和保险。
小富即安, 积分 2793, 距离下一级还需 2207 积分
论坛徽章:12
32的系统运行64的程序会有问题吧?
编译的话,加个编译参数应该就行吧。
大牛指教。
家境小康, 积分 1752, 距离下一级还需 248 积分
论坛徽章:0
论坛徽章:95
VIP_fuck 发表于
32的系统运行64的程序会有问题吧?
编译的话,加个编译参数应该就行吧。
大牛指教。
编译和运行都是看情况的,大部分都是没有问题的。当然,运行的话前提是你的 CPU 是 64 位的,且内核支持 64 位程序的运行。
白手起家, 积分 167, 距离下一级还需 33 积分
论坛徽章:1
32位系统是可以编译出64位的应用程序的,
32位的系统上安装一个64位的编译器,
但是64位的应用程序是一定不能运行在32位系统上的。
论坛徽章:95
palm008 发表于
但是64位的应用程序是一定不能运行在32位系统上的。
这个看你怎么定义&32位系统“了。其实,只要 kernel 是 64 位的(或支持 64 位程序运行),有需要的动态库(包括 loader),就可以运行 64 位程序了。
北京盛拓优讯信息技术有限公司. 版权所有 京ICP备号 北京市公安局海淀分局网监中心备案编号:22
广播电视节目制作经营许可证(京) 字第1234号
中国互联网协会会员&&联系我们:
感谢所有关心和支持过ChinaUnix的朋友们
转载本站内容请注明原作者名及出处博客访问: 2900416
博文数量: 1014
博客积分: 12961
博客等级: 上将
技术积分: 12025
注册时间:
偷得浮生半桶水(半日闲), 好记性不如抄下来(烂笔头).
信息爆炸的时代, 学习是一项持续的工作.
分类: LINUX 16:23:23
最近搞一款博通的安全芯片bcm5892, broadcom提供的sdk 4.4 只有在运行64位的系统上才OK, 老外很前列。 OK, 安装ubuntu 11.04 x64版本, 编译,靠居然出现libgcc_s libc 等找不到或者不兼容的情况,对方 FAE 说是要使用32位的库。
1.Ubuntu 11.04 x64 OS
2.Sudo apt-get install
bison libglib2.0-dev aptitude
&&&&&& sudo aptitude install ia32-libs& (先用 aptitude search ia32 查看是否存在32位库包)
3.设置 env44.sh
4.进入 projects/bcm589x/build/ make BOARD=BCM9589x
5.期间要修改把gstreamer 中的 win32/common/gstenumtypes.h 文件拷贝到 gst 目录下覆盖原有文件。(原有文件是空内容)
怎么样才能使32位的程序在64位的计算机上运行?
现在,在这些64位的计算机上,您可以选择安装64位的Ubuntu。请注意:不是所有的程序都能够正常的运行在64位平台上。更多的non-free项目都是在32位平台上的,比如32位平台上的Flash插件。不过还是有一些32位应用程序可以通过使用32位运行库来实现在64位Ubuntu平台上的正常运行。你可以使用sudo和apt-get命令来安装这些运行库。
sudo apt-get install ia32-libs*
你也可以通过安装 Synaptic package manager 或者通过安装 chroot 来建造一个32位的环境。
文章来自:大学生校园网-VvSchool.CN 详文参考:
Ubuntu 64位系统安装32位运行库
日 星期五 下午 02:43
sudo apt-get install ia32-libs*
安装32位包:
安装时加 --force-architecture
例如:sudo dpkg --force-architecture -i linuxqq_i386.deb
反安装用 sudo dpkg -P 软件名
例如:sudo dpkg -P linuxqq
安装getlibs,新立得里如果没有就在这里下载:
GetLibs的使用方法:(常用参数)
下载和安装一个软件所需的所有libs:
getlibs /usr/bin/skype
通过lib名将一个32位库安装在64位系统上:(-l参数)
getlibs -l libogg.so.0 libSDL-1.2.so.0
通过软件包名安装32位的库:(-p参数)
getlibs -p libqt4-core libqt4-gui
安装一个32位lib的.deb文件:(-i参数)
getlibs -i ~/i386_library_1.deb
下载和安装一个32位lib文件:(-w参数)
getlibs -w
阅读(27022)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~
请登录后评论。Arch Linux32位系统还能用吗?Arch Linux32位下架了吗?
时间: 09:47:14
来源:网络
编辑:yangxiaorong
Arch Linux32位系统还能用吗?Arch Linux32位下架了吗?据悉,Arch Linux不再提供32位支持:镜像下线 无法下载。我们一起看看。要知道,如今64位处理器已经彻底普及,而操作系统们也在陆续放弃32位,比如苹果iOS,比如Ubuntu,即便是Windows平台上64位也已经成为绝对主流,很多设备驱动和软件也不再支持32位。今天,主打轻量化、简单的Arch Linux发行版正式终结了对32位的支持,所有的32位镜像都会在本月底下线。其实在今年初,Arch Linux方面就宣布将从3月1日开始逐步淡化32位支持,每月镜像中不再提供32位版本。Arch Linux 就成了最后的32位镜像,而且如今9个月的支持期限已经结束,11月8日开始生效。到本月底,所有的32位版Arch Linux安装镜像都会从官方网站上移除,镜像下载和历史档案中都不再提供。如果你依然需要32位版的Arch Linux,可以尝试社区爱好者制作的Arch Linux 32。
喜欢这文章可以分享给您的朋友哦
Arch Linux不再提供32位支持:镜像下线 无法下载。要知道,如今64位处理...
老设备没有被遗忘!iOS9.1-9.3.4的32位Trident越狱工具发布。此前盘古越...
微软 Office 2016 for Mac 将升级为 64 位版本,好在这次从 32 位到 64 ...
在经历了数月的开发之后,将CentOS 7移植到32位(i686/x86)硬件架构的工...
电脑系统有分32位和64位的,同时兼容的软件也要区分开,64位系统可以通用...
Arch Linux不再提供32位支持:镜像下线 无法下载。要知道,如今64位处理...
Win10秋季更新官方原版镜像下载地址:64位、32位简体中文专业/家庭版!据...
苹果在iOS11测试版中对32位应用下了狠手,具体来说就是,新系统已经取消...
还在用32位设备吗?针对32位设备的iOS 9.3.5降级工具即将到来。alitek12...
新越狱测试工具发布:支持32位iOS 9设备。开发者 jk9357 日前发布了仅支持...
老设备没有被遗忘!iOS9.1-9.3.4的32位Trident越狱工具发布。此前盘古越...
微软 Office 2016 for Mac 将升级为 64 位版本,好在这次从 32 位到 64 ...
今天,谷歌宣布自2016年3月上旬开始将不再为部分GNU/Linux操作系统继续提...
  查询自己CPU支持32位还是64位,可以帮助我们了解匹配自己点奥系统,...
在经过了漫长的等待之后,盘古越狱团队终于发布了 iOS 9.2-9.3.3 完美越...

我要回帖

更多关于 32位系统不支持uefi 的文章

 

随机推荐